type RetryOptions = {
retries?: number;
delayMs?: number;
shouldRetry?: (error: ExtensionError, attempt: number) => boolean;
backoffFactor?: number; // multiplier for exponential backoff
};
async function retryWithBackoff<T>(fn: () => Promise<T>, options: RetryOptions = {}): Promise<T> {
const { retries = 3, delayMs = 1000, backoffFactor = 1.5, shouldRetry = () => true } = options;
let attempt = 0;
let lastError: ExtensionError;
while (attempt <= retries) {
try {
return await fn();
} catch (err) {
lastError = err as ExtensionError;
attempt++;
if (attempt > retries || !shouldRetry(lastError, attempt)) {
break;
}
const waitTime = delayMs * Math.pow(backoffFactor, attempt - 1);
console.warn(`Retry attempt ${attempt} failed. Retrying in ${waitTime}ms...`, err);
await new Promise((res) => setTimeout(res, waitTime));
}
}
throw lastError;
}
